AGUILAR ROS, Alejandra. El santuario de Santo Toribio romo en los altos jaliscienses: La periferia en el Centro. Nueva antropol [online]. 2016, vol.29, n.84, pp.91-116. ISSN 0185-0636.

This article presents the emergence of the sanctuary of Santo Toribio Romo in Los Altos Jaliscienses, shows the way in which the intertwining of what is heard and seen in the media, tourism and migration make up the holy spaces and circuits of faith which have their roots in historic practices of Catholicism and the esthetics of the region. The articulation of local devotional practices with transnational threads admits that the idea of a fixed center from which the luminous power is emitted and towards which one must move is moved off-center in order to understand this sanctuary as a constellation of articulated elements which are set in motion. Understanding the performance of these historical-cultural practices as well as taking into account the movement (circularity) of persons, symbols and practices which make up a sanctuary is relevant in building new categories for understanding these kinds of studies.
